The Blessed Buddha once
said: I will teach you the origination and passing
away of the
objects of the
Four
Foundations of Awareness. Listen to that:
Appearance of
Nutriment
produces emergence
of Body.
Disappearance of
Nutriment
produces passing away of Body.
Appearance of
Contact
produces emergence of
Feeling.
Disappearance of
Contact
produces passing away of Feeling.
Appearance of
Name-&-form
produces
emergence of Mind.
Disappearance of
Name-&-form
produces passing away of Mind.
Appearance of
Attention produces emergence
of Phenomena.
Disappearance of
Attention produces passing away of Phenomena.
Therefore: Considering,
contemplating, analyzing, and always recollecting:
Body merely as transient forms grown on
& out of Food;
Feeling only as passing emotions arised from Contact;
Mind just as changing moods emerged from Naming-&-Forming; &
Phenomena as momentary mental states created by Attention...
repeatedly, thoroughly, and completely,
is called initiating & developing the
Four Foundations
of Awareness, which - in itself - is the mental treasure
par excellence, leading steadily and straight to the
Deathless Element...
Deep, deep, subtle and
somewhat enigmatic is this profound classification!
